Social media by proxy: Managing online information for adults with dementia
  As social media use by older people increases, along with an increased rate of dementia diagnoses, the management or oversight of social networking sites by carers is likely to increase. This research aims to investigate the “lived experiences” of people who act as “social media proxies”, managing the social networking profiles and online information for adults with dementia.
The proposed research combines two research areas at Edinburgh Napier University’s Centre for Social Informatics: (1) the use of online information in the management of personal reputation and (2) digital tools help care staff get to know personal and social information about clients with dementia living in residential care facilities.
